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Aberdeen

There are a number of factors that can influence your total installation cost, such as the size of your system, the equipment you choose, your financing options and the specific company that installs your solar system.

Solar Equipment

The size of the solar system you need for your household, which is measured in kilowatts, is the most important cost factor to consider. For every additional kilowatt you need, your total will most likely increase by around $3,540. The brand and kind of equipment you want for your solar system can raise or lower the price quite significantly. If you prefer a trusted brand name like Tesla or SunPower, these often come at a higher price than other brands. Efficiency also matters. Whether you’re opting for high efficiency because you have limited roof space or just want maximum energy production, you will be looking at a higher equipment cost, but this can typically lead to greater savings over time. Plus, if you want add-ons like an electric vehicle charger or solar batteries, this will also raise the cost.

Solar Financing Terms

If paying for solar panels in cash is too expensive, solar loans are an affordable option because they cut back your upfront costs and allow you to pay for your system over a term of, on average, between five and seven years.It’s wise to add the interest you’ll pay in your final cost estimate. If you can afford to put more money down upfront, you can reduce your total costs and the amount of time it’ll take to pay off the loan.

How to Save on Solar Panels

There are many solar installers to choose from, all of which offer different warranties, solar panel models and price points. To help you pick the right company for you, here are some tips to keep in mind:

  • Reputation: Long-standing companies likely have a solid reputation. This is important because it ensures that it will not only see your solar project through, but will also provide quality aftercare and customer service, such as part repairs and replacements.
  • Warranty: If you’re worried about the endurance of your solar system, verifying that your installer offers a 25-year, all-inclusive warranty can give you some peace of mind.
  • Installation Process: Make sure you’re aligned with the installer in regard to how the installation process will go and what needs to be done before your solar panel system is installed, such as repairing your electrical system or roof.
  • Solar Panel Brands: Not all solar installers offer the same brands of solar panels, so the brand and type of panel you want can play a significant role in the company you hire.

How many solar panels do I need to power my home?

The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y needs and the amount of sunlight your roof gets. You can look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to install between 20 and 35 panels to cover their typical energy usage.
